如何在用户按下按钮或图像后显示 Google Picker API 对话框?

2023-12-09

有 HTML 专家可以帮助我吗?

我想展示Google 选择器 API 对话框用户单击按钮或图像后,我想随后在页面上显示结果。对于知道如何进行 Web 编程的开发人员来说,这应该很简单。

如何使用的示例代码位于上面的链接中。十分感谢。


现在我自己解决了。 Google Javascript API 的主要加载器是 Google Loader。

看看这里的文档:http://code.google.com/intl/en/apis/loader/

在里面插入这段代码<head> ... </head>HTML(Google 文档选择器)。点击选择器后加载的主要功能是newPicker()。它加载选择器并设置第一个回调来处理选择器。

<script src="http://www.google.com/jsapi"></script>
<script type="text/javascript">   

    // Google Picker API for the Google Docs import
    function newPicker() {
        google.load('picker', '1', {"callback" : createPicker});
    }       

    // Create and render a Picker object for selecting documents
    function createPicker() {
        var picker = new google.picker.PickerBuilder().
            addView(google.picker.ViewId.DOCUMENTS).
            setCallback(pickerCallback).
            build();
        picker.setVisible(true);
    }

    // A simple callback implementation which sets some ids to the picker values.
    function pickerCallback(data) {
        if(data.action == google.picker.Action.PICKED){
            document.getElementById('gdocs_resource_id').value = google.picker.ResourceId.generate(data.docs[0]);
            document.getElementById('gdocs_access_token').value = data.docs[0].accessToken;                  
        }
    }    
 </script>

HTML 中的链接:

<a href="javascript:newPicker()" style="font-weight: bold">Import from your Google Docs</a>

当用户单击 HTML 链接时,将显示选择器。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何在用户按下按钮或图像后显示 Google Picker API 对话框? 的相关文章

随机推荐

  • WebSecurityConfigurerAdapter 中 httpBasic 和 jdbcAuthentication 的用户验证问题

    我检查了 stackoverflow 上的大部分解决方案以及一些官方文章 例如 spring io我已经完成了基于的小webapi春季启动我想更改安全级别内存认证 to jdbc身份验证我认为我的代码是正确的 但我不知道为什么我仍然有401
  • 如何 (.htaccess) 重写特定搜索查询的 url?

    我希望 htaccess 在具有 custom title 参数时重写搜索查询的网址 有人可以帮助我吗 我想重写这个网址 http www mysite com search php search query myquery custom
  • 经过大量阅读后,我仍然无法让 Pathogen 在 Windows 下加载插件

    对于 Windows 7 64 位上的 gVim 7 3 46 完全更新 我运行 gVim 7 3 46 因为它在 Windows 上下文菜单中添加了一个可靠的 使用 Vim 编辑 实例 尽管阅读了大量文章 其中许多文章重复了其他文章 但我
  • 我想知道如果系统上的 aslr 关闭,pie 是否会执行任何操作?还是pie依赖于aslr?

    我还想知道 pie 和 aslr 在内存中的作用是什么 据我所知 aslr 随机化 libc 基地址 堆栈和堆的地址 饼图随机化 elf 基数 并使用 text data bss rodata 这是正确的还是我理解错了 PIE 需要与位置无
  • 如果需要迁移,领域不会自动删除数据库

    我们正在开发中 数据库架构更改经常发生 由于我们不再活着 因此不需要迁移 因此我将 Realm 配置如下 RealmConfiguration config new RealmConfiguration Builder context na
  • 检查 XSLT 中的字符串是否为 Null 或空

    如何检查值是否为 null 或空XSL 例如 如果categoryName是空的 我正在使用一个选择时构造 例如
  • Android 内存不足问题 [已关闭]

    很难说出这里问的是什么 这个问题模棱两可 含糊不清 不完整 过于宽泛或言辞激烈 无法以目前的形式合理回答 如需帮助澄清此问题以便重新打开 访问帮助中心 我的应用程序面临内存不足问题 经过一番搜索 我发现了这段代码 decodes image
  • MKLocalSearch 没有找到明显的结果

    我的代码实际上与以下示例相同 https github com iamamused Example MKLocalSearch git 以下是重要的部分 interface ViewController UIViewController p
  • .mdf 文件上的实体框架

    我现在正在做一些项目 我必须使用本地数据库 因此 我创建了一个新的基于服务的数据库 没有表 atm 然后我想添加实体框架支持 因为我以前从未使用过实体框架 所以我指的是该链接 http msdn microsoft com en us da
  • 忽略更新函数 Laravel 5 的唯一验证

    我有这个customer当您创建时的模型具有独特的phone num 它在创建中工作得很好 但在我的更新功能中工作得很好 这是一个基于自动填充值的表单id 如果用户只更新了address正如预期的unique验证将再次触发说The phon
  • 如何在 iOS 中同时播放两个音频文件

    我正在开发一个带有声音文件的应用程序 在此应用程序中 有一个滑块实现 根据滑块比率 将处理所有文件以设置音量 但有了这种音量效果 假设有字段 A 和 B 的声音集 就会有两组不同文件的声音组合 将有 A 文件的 75 和 B 文件的 25
  • 不返回 python 正则表达式中的整个模式

    我有以下代码 haystack aaa months 3 bbb needle re compile r months days d instances list set needle findall haystack print str
  • 查找 DOM 节点索引

    我想找到给定 DOM 节点的索引 这就像做的相反 document getElementById id of element childNodes K 我想提取的值K鉴于我已经有了对子节点和父节点的引用 我该怎么做呢 在所有版本的 Safa
  • iPhone - NSWeekCalendarUnit 和 NSWeekdayCalendarUnit 之间有什么区别?

    我试图使用这些值设置 UILocalNotification 的重复间隔 但一如既往 Apple 文档非常模糊 有什么线索吗 thanks 也许看看我刚刚发现的这个博客关于主题 AFAIK NSCalendarUnits主要用于将日期或时间
  • 使用模型描述中的标题属性创建 CheckboxFor MVC 帮助程序

    我创建了一个文本框助手来添加取自模型中字段的描述属性的标题 工具提示 public static MvcHtmlString TextBoxForWithTitle
  • EPPlus 日期单元格数据类型不起作用

    我有一些代码接受 IEnumerable 并从中生成 Excel 文档 IEnumerable 中的对象有一个日期字段 我希望将它们格式化为 Excel 中的日期 但是 当您在 Excel 中查看时 日期似乎不是 日期 数据类型 直到您双击
  • 带 GDI 的黑色高亮条

    我为我的 GUI 提供了一些不错的分割器代码 但我无法获得笔 画笔 无论我需要做适当的突出显示是什么 您知道在 Visual Studio 10 中如何拖动分割条 并且有一个漂亮的黑色透明条让您知道当您抬起鼠标按钮时分割将发生在哪里 这是一
  • WooCommerce 客户帐单地址

    我正在尝试将增值税字段添加到客户账单地址 而这可以在结账页面上使用以下代码 Company Name Required add filter woocommerce checkout fields custom override check
  • 龙卷风协程函数中的变量会发生什么情况?

    我对非阻塞 IO 的概念很陌生 并且有一些事情我无法理解 关于协程 考虑这段代码 class UserPostHandler RequestHandler gen coroutine def get self var some variab
  • 如何在用户按下按钮或图像后显示 Google Picker API 对话框?

    有 HTML 专家可以帮助我吗 我想展示Google 选择器 API 对话框用户单击按钮或图像后 我想随后在页面上显示结果 对于知道如何进行 Web 编程的开发人员来说 这应该很简单 如何使用的示例代码位于上面的链接中 十分感谢 现在我自己